More than two-thirds (70%) of UK businesses have been the victim of a successful network security attack in the last year and 65% have been the victim of at least one ransomware attack in the last 12 months, according to new research from Barracuda.
These findings were released in a new report titled: The state of network security in 2021. Commissioned by Barracuda, the research surveyed 100 UK IT decision-makers responsible for their organisation’s networking, public cloud and security to get their perspectives on cloud adoption, working from home, security concerns and a variety of issues and challenges related to cybersecurity risks.
Tim Jefferson, SVP, Engineering for Data, Networks and Application Security, Barracuda: “Organisations are experiencing a high level of network breaches and facing ongoing connectivity and security challenges as they adapt to hybrid work environments.”
The data revealed that a significant 80% of respondents with company-issued devices share their home Internet connection with other members of their household, posing a significant security risk. Furthermore, 34% of UK companies do not issue company devices and instead operated a Bring Your Own Device (BYOD) policy and an additional 43% of companies do issue company devices, but still allow BYOD for some use cases such as email.
